시편(Psalms)
저자 : 다윗 73, 아삽 12, 고라자손 10, 솔로몬 2, 모세 1, 헤만 1, 에단 1(100편)
기록연대 : B.C 1500-500
기록목적 :
개인의 내적인 기쁨이나 슬픔을 찬양, 또는 고백하기 위하여 일상생활이나 종교행위에 있어 교훈을 주기 위하여
줄거리 :
시편은 온갖 종류의 인간의 감정이나 경험을 노래함으로 누구나 즐겨 읊도록 되어 있다 그리고 무엇보다도 살아계신 하나님에 대한 깊은 신앙을 나타내고 있다. 이 책은 제 5권으로 구성되었는데, 제 1권은 1-41편, 제 2권은 42-72편, 제 3권은 73-89편, b 제 4권은 90-106편, 제 5권은 107-150편 까지다.

69 장

  • 1 Save me, O God; for the waters are come in unto my soul.

  • 2 I sink in deep mire, where there is no standing: I am come into deep waters, where the floods overflow me.

  • 3 I am weary of my crying: my throat is dried: mine eyes fail while I wait for my God.

  • 4 They that hate me without a cause are more than the hairs of mine head: they that would destroy me, being mine enemies wrongfully, are mighty: then I restored that which I took not away.

  • 5 O God, thou knowest my foolishness; and my sins are not hid from thee.

  • 6 Let not them that wait on thee, O Lord GOD of hosts, be ashamed for my sake: let not those that seek thee be confounded for my sake, O God of Israel.

  • 7 Because for thy sake I have borne reproach; shame hath covered my face.

  • 8 I am become a stranger unto my brethren, and an alien unto my mother's children.

  • 9 For the zeal of thine house hath eaten me up; and the reproaches of them that reproached thee are fallen upon me.

  • 10 When I wept, and chastened my soul with fasting, that was to my reproach.

  • 11 I made sackcloth also my garment; and I became a proverb to them.

  • 12 They that sit in the gate speak against me; and I was the song of the drunkards.

  • 13 But as for me, my prayer is unto thee, O LORD, in an acceptable time: O God, in the multitude of thy mercy hear me, in the truth of thy salvation.

  • 14 Deliver me out of the mire, and let me not sink: let me be delivered from them that hate me, and out of the deep waters.

  • 15 Let not the waterflood overflow me, neither let the deep swallow me up, and let not the pit shut her mouth upon me.

  • 16 Hear me, O LORD; for thy lovingkindness is good: turn unto me according to the multitude of thy tender mercies.

  • 17 And hide not thy face from thy servant; for I am in trouble: hear me speedily.

  • 18 Draw nigh unto my soul, and redeem it: deliver me because of mine enemies.

  • 19 Thou hast known my reproach, and my shame, and my dishonour: mine adversaries are all before thee.

  • 20 Reproach hath broken my heart; and I am full of heaviness: and I looked for some to take pity, but there was none; and for comforters, but I found none.

  • 21 They gave me also gall for my meat; and in my thirst they gave me vinegar to drink.

  • 22 Let their table become a snare before them: and that which should have been for their welfare, let it become a trap.

  • 23 Let their eyes be darkened, that they see not; and make their loins continually to shake.

  • 24 Pour out thine indignation upon them, and let thy wrathful anger take hold of them.

  • 25 Let their habitation be desolate; and let none dwell in their tents.

  • 26 For they persecute him whom thou hast smitten; and they talk to the grief of those whom thou hast wounded.

  • 27 Add iniquity unto their iniquity: and let them not come into thy righteousness.

  • 28 Let them be blotted out of the book of the living, and not be written with the righteous.

  • 29 But I am poor and sorrowful: let thy salvation, O God, set me up on high.

  • 30 I will praise the name of God with a song, and will magnify him with thanksgiving.

  • 31 This also shall please the LORD better than an ox or bullock that hath horns and hoofs.

  • 32 The humble shall see this, and be glad: and your heart shall live that seek God.

  • 33 For the LORD heareth the poor, and despiseth not his prisoners.

  • 34 Let the heaven and earth praise him, the seas, and every thing that moveth therein.

  • 35 For God will save Zion, and will build the cities of Judah: that they may dwell there, and have it in possession.

  • 36 The seed also of his servants shall inherit it: and they that love his name shall dwell therein.
